Max King has been cleared to return for this afternoon's clash with the Knights at Accor Stadium.

King was in doubt for the match following a hand injury sustained in Round 5 and was named in an extended squad for this weekend's battle against the Knights as an outside chance to play. Having made it successfully through the week, he re-joins the starting line-up.

Sam Hughes will start from the interchange while Poasa Fa'amausili drops out from this afternoon's match, having played in the earlier NSW Cup win over the Knights, 52-6. Jake Turpin comes in at 18th man.

The Bulldogs otherwise take an unchanged team into the Round 7 clash.

Canterbury will be gunning for their third win of the season, cheered on by a home crowd and motivated for redemption against Newcastle.
